Just be disappointed . The execution of code stops at these points. SolidWorks Pattern Feature Tutorial Complete | Linear Pattern, Circular Pattern, Curve Driven Pattern. You need external tools like Visual Studio to develop the software. In this example, we have tread on the sole of a shoe made with two Variable Patterns. Click here for information about technical support. To report problems encountered with the Web help interface and search, contact your local support representative. Thenattempted to project separate curves from side and bottom (becausethe lugs also wrap around a radius) joined them withcomposite 3D sketch and lofted surfaces between these curves tocreate the variable wrapping draft. You cannot do proper version control because the SWP file is not a text file. The SOLIDWORKS software does the following: The solution to the global variable appears in the. Because of all that experience, I know my way around the SOLIDWORKS API. It is good practice to start your macro with a few lines on the who, why and how. Command variables control the state of drawings, options and preferences in commands, aspects of the user interface, and settings for drawing, editing, and viewing modes.
How to Use SolidWorks Draft Features Tool in SolidWorks CAD document.getElementById( "ak_js_1" ).setAttribute( "value", ( new Date() ).getTime() ); Your email address will not be published. Lets modify one of the instances manually using Instant3D. When you create a variable pattern, you choose which dimensions to vary. A heatmap (aka heat map) depicts values for a main variable of interest across two axis variables as a grid of colored squares. Can be created in VBA (Visual Basic for Applications), VB (Visual Basic, formerly VB.net) and C#. Open the solidworks cad software and create new part file. Working with Blocks, BlockAttributes, EntityGroups, and References, Working with Hatches, Color Fills, Text, and Tables, Creating Layout Sheets and Printing Drawings. Your video is so informative and easy to understand. You can apply draft to solid or surface models. This makes it easier to find out their type and makes it easier to spot problems. Set two or more dimensions equal to the global variable. If you only want to work with the ModelDoc2 object, you dont need these checks. Read Creating macro buttons in SOLIDWORKS toolbars for more information.
Utilizing SOLIDWORKS Variable Pattern in Designs This page contains a library of useful macros, utilities and scripts for SOLIDWORKS engineers. From the neutral plane, the inner or outer face tapering or drafting is possible and no changes will happening to neutral plane. Terms of Use Checking the model type to prevent errors. The macro recorder does record most actions that create geometry or features. Power Shell script to export part file to parasolid format (.xmp_bin) from command line via Document Manager API (without SOLIDWORKS), Macro will display the callouts with the diameter values of all selected circular edges in the 3D model, Macro runs VBA code (or another macro) automatically on file load using SOLIDWORKS API, Macro runs VBA code (or another macro) automatically on file save using SOLIDWORKS API, VBA macro to run other macros or code on every new document creation using SOLIDWORKS API, VBA Macro to set title with automatically incremented number from the shared file using SOLIDWORKS API for new files, VBA macro to remove all items (annotations, sketch segments, blocks etc) from the specified layer in SOLIDWORKS document, Macro removes all of the equations (or optionally only broken equations) in the active model (part or assembly), Macro will create child configuration where all the dimension will be set to average value based on the minimum and maximum values of the tolerance, Macro replaces the text in the dimension names of the selected feature or features, VBA macro deletes all empty feature folders in the SOLIDWORKS files (part or assembly), Macro allows to delete all of the features in the selected folder in one click using SOLIDWORKS API, VBA macro finds and deletes all features below the rollback bar, Macro renames all the features in the order preserving the base names using SOLIDWORKS API, VBA macro to show text from comments in the active document using SOLIDWORKS API, VBA macro which updates coordinates of the free form (through XYZ points) curve from the linked external text file, VBA macro feature which allows to configure the dimensions of the model via custom user Form, Macro feature to run VBA code on model loading using SOLIDWORKS API, Macro allows to automatically run macros on every rebuild using the macro feature and designed binder attachment with SOLIDWORKS API, VBA macro to print SOLIDWORKS documents using the specified settings (printer name, printer range, orientation, paper size and scale), VBA Macro to select all features in the active SOLIDWORKS model (part, assembly or drawing) by specifying its type, Example demonstrates how to select standard plane (Top, Front or Right) and origin by specifying its type, VBA macro to automatically assign new file name for the document based on the referenced drawing view or custom property using SOLIDWORKS API, Macro exports selected table or specified tables (BOM, General Table, Revision etc.) Example: Moved the variable declarations to the top of the program for clarity (2020 update: dont create a long list of all variables at the top of your program). You can then create a button in your toolbar to run the macro whenever you need it again. Global variables inSOLIDWORKSare user-defined names that are assigned numeric values. SOLIDWORKS welcomes your feedback concerning the presentation, accuracy, and thoroughness of the documentation. We will create aVariable Patternof this slot and specify some dimension parameters to get variation in the patterned instances. The functionality hasnt changed a bit though. The tool will select all faces and apply set draft angle to the all faces according to selected neutral pane. They make it easier to understand and modify equations. On the Feature Toolbar make sure Instant3D is enabled. The parting line can be non-planar. Article by Brandon Harris on Jul 28, 2021. are user-defined names that are assigned numeric values. You will see each type of drafting step by step tutorial in this post. HTML5 video, Enroll molar enthalpy of combustion of methanol. The effect of face propagation in Solidworks draft tool is shown below. To learn more, check out my blog series on the SOLIDWORKS API. If you have ever wanted to pattern a feature and have the patterned instances vary in size/shape/location, the SOLIDWORKSVariable Patterntool can help. Search 'Drafts' in the SOLIDWORKS Knowledge Base.
Drafts - 2019 - SOLIDWORKS Help Alternately you can right-click on the Equations Folder in the feature tree and select Modify equations. You can write macros in three Microsoft-based programming languages. Here you can see and modify all the equations and global variables.
SolidWorks Quick Tip - Global Variables and Equations - Hawk Ridge Sys Selecting a Feature Based on Number of Sides. Dont even bother trying to remember all options. To provide feedback on individual help topics, use the Feedback on this topic link on the individual topic page. If you perform optimization with discrete variables only, the program selects the optimal solution from one of the defined scenarios.   1995-2023Dassault Systmes. You define global variables in the Equations dialog box. This variable is used in every SOLIDWORKS macro and most people call it swApp to be able to read each others' code easily. This lets you know SOLIDWORKS is going to create a global variable. The documentation team cannot answer technical support questions. After that, your new add-in appears in the list of available add-ins: Add-ins can be built by SOLIDWORKS (like SOLIDWORKS Routing) or by third parties like CAD Booster. General - Solidworks Functions Introduction Open new Part document Open Assembly and Drawing document Selection Methods Open Saved Documents Fix Unit Issue Sketch - Lines Create Line Create CenterLine Sketch - Rectangles Create Corner Rectangle Create Center Rectangle Create 3-Point Corner Rectangle Create 3-Point Center Rectangle View menu.
variable draft in solidworks From there you can run it line by line by pressing F8, this is a great way to debug your own code or to get to know another macro. I myself am a mechanical engineer by trade. So dont be surprised if your action does not show up in the macro. Note: Some variables are present only for compatibility with other CAD programs or for legacy reasons to older software. This line adds the contents of one or multiple variables to the Immediate Window, as long as they contain text or numbers. By left-clicking before a line, you can add Break Points. To do this, create the seed feature with at least one reference to the nonplanar surface. We'll start by chopping the model in half, and finish by mirroring the half-body back onto itself, to take advantage of part symmetry.
Solidworks Interview Questions and Answers: Updated in April 2020 Solidworks Introduction EN - INTRODUCING SOLIDWORKS Contents Legal Command variables control the state of drawings, options and preferences in commands, aspects of the user interface, and settings for drawing, editing, and viewing modes. |Personalize Cookie Choices A new feature is created using the selected sketch and a whole lot of options. In neutral plane draft, you should select a base plane or neutral plane, from where the tapering of face have to be applied.
SolidWorks Tutorial - How to dimension using equations and variables in Theres no need to use the ugly gray user interfaces from 20 years ago from Windows Forms. By now, I can build a simple macro in two minutes. For more information, see Creating Basic Draft Features. Or maybe you can draft individual faces and build the transition manually. Define an additional scenario by selecting the check box in the column of the previous scenario. As of June 2022, Microsoft will no longer support Internet Explorer. Open Variable pattern feature dialog from linear pattern dropdown. You can, however, create a function that returns no value, To create a function that returns a value, type. I would renamed myFeature to swFeat, also a convention. So Register/ Signup to have Access all the Course and Videos. eDrawings, html, stl, jpeg, etc.) (I repeated the image to make the post more readable). This variable is used in every SOLIDWORKS macro and most people call it, It starts with a prefix (sw) to help you understand its type (a. Basic Commands: Cut, Copy, Paste, Undo, and Redo, Create and Edit Equations in the Equations Dialog Box, Create Equations in the Modify Dialog Box, Direct Input of Equations in PropertyManagers, Equations with Exponents of Negative Numbers or Variables, Replacing Equation References for Deleted Features, Defining Parameters for Parametric Design Studies, Future Version Components in Earlier Releases, Working with the 3DEXPERIENCE Platform and 3DEXPERIENCE Apps, Using 3DEXPERIENCE Marketplace | Make from SOLIDWORKS, Using 3DEXPERIENCE Marketplace | PartSupply from SOLIDWORKS, Linking Dimensions Using Global Variables. SOLIDWORKS does not record all of your actions, though. upgrading
Drafts in Solidworks - A Step By Step Guide - LearnVern Here are some useful sites when you want to get started with building macros for SOLIDWORKS: Doing a Google search in the form of SOLIDWORKS API [your search term] will also do miracles.
SOLIDWORKS Variable Pattern Tool Explained | GoEngineer You can create variable patterns for these features: You can use variable patterns to pattern features across nonplanar surfaces while maintaining design intent. The preview shows the instance variation. |Get a Quote TheSOLIDWORKSVariable Patterntoolis powerfulallowing extreme flexibility in your patterns and design intent, without having to recreate similar geometry.